Ticket MQ-904: Log compaction stalls on Brineport queue cluster. Compaction threads on partition leaders stop advancing after roughly six hours, causing segment counts to climb and disk pressure alerts. Suspected cause: the tombstone sweep holds a read lock that the retention scanner also requests, producing a soft deadlock. Workaround for on-call: restart the compactor process only — do not bounce the broker, as that forces leader re-election and amplifies lag. Reproduced reliably on the staging build identified below.

build token for tawip-yageg: htk9_92ac43d42

Postmortem action item: config hot-reload (Quillgate incident)

Hot-reload applied a half-written config file, crashing three workers. Fix: reloads now require an atomic rename plus checksum match, with a debounce so rapid edits coalesce into one apply. New folks: never edit configs in place on a box; write to a temp file and rename. A failed validation keeps the last good config and alerts. The debounce and retry behavior is governed by these constants:

tuning table, kajog-bawip:
TIERS = {
    "kelius": 256,
    "lammir": 543,
}

Ticket: Vault locked — Driftwarden sweeper credentials

The Driftwarden orphaned-resource sweeper stopped mid-run because its credentials vault at Hallowmere went into lockdown after repeated auth failures. As the incoming contractor, please do not retry logins — that extends the lockout. Instead, use the vault's recovery flow from the sweeper admin host, verify the run ID with the platform lead, and enter the recovery passphrase exactly as written on the next line.

vault phrase of hawif-bahof = novvan-belius-istael-fenvan-holdor-druox-eliath